目的介绍成人房间隔缺损(ASD)并发心房颤动(AF)患者的几种治疗方法,并分析其治疗效果。方法:回顾分析本院136例ASD并发有明显临床症状且药物治疗无效的AF病例,其中36例接受介入封堵+经导管射频消融术(导管射频消融组),84例体外循环下ASD补术+改良迷宫术(改良迷宫组),16例单纯介入封堵术(未行经导管射频消融术,单纯介入封堵组),术前,术后12月用心脏超声仪评价右心房、右室内径及肺动脉压力和心电图变化。结果:所有病例的术中、术后均未出现严重并发症,所有病例均无死亡,随访12个月,36例接受介入封堵+经导管射频消融术28例转复为窦性心律,8例仍为AF,后行二次射频消融术转为窦性心律,84例ASD补术+改良迷宫手术患者中有66例转复窦性,14例失败仍为AF,4例为交界性心律,单纯介入封堵组16例8例成功,8例术后仍为AF,与术前比较,各组心脏超声检查示右心房、右心室内径均较术前明显缩小,肺动脉压力明显下降(均P〈0.05)。各组之间无显著差异。经导管射频消融组和改良迷宫手术组AF治愈率高(对比单纯介入组,均P〈0.05),患者心慌不适更能得到改善,生活质量更高。结论:介入封堵及外科手术均能安全有效治疗ASD并发AF,每种方法各有利弊,可依据患者临床具体情况选择。  相似文献

射频迷宫术治疗心房颤动   总被引:12,自引:4,他引:12  
为探讨射频迷宫术治疗心房颤动(简称房颤)的效果,比较18例二尖瓣置换术中加做迷宫术(治疗组)和18例单纯二尖瓣置换术(对照组)的慢性房颤治疗结果。治疗组前2例采用切割冷冻法完成迷宫术,后16例采用改良的射频法。其中16例(88.9%)于术后当日至22日转为窦性心律。切割冷冻法有1例因术后出血给予大量输血引起急性肾功能衰竭而死亡,余未见明显并发症。随访2~12个月未见房颤复发。对照组中5例曾于术后恢复短暂窦性心律,但出院时又转为房颤。结果表明迷宫术能有效地治愈慢性房颤,改良的射频法比切割冷冻法操作简单,无出血并发症,心房肌损伤小。提示心房的大小、f波的粗细、心功能的好坏等是影响迷宫术成功的因素  相似文献

射频消蚀右侧房室旁路的体会   总被引:6,自引:0,他引:6  
以导管射频消蚀右侧房室旁路患者22例,占同期消蚀旁路总数的22%;其中包括显性者13例(59%),隐性者9例(41%)。2例合并有Mahaim氏束,1例合并有隐性左侧旁路。全部消蚀成功,随访1~11个月,3例复发(14%),均已再次消蚀成功。我们认为准确的旁路定位及消蚀导管与靶组织的接触是成功的关键。  相似文献

目的:探讨射频导管消融改良房室结术中发生一过性完全性房室传导阻滞(TCAVB)的预后意义。方法:对56例房室结折返性心动过速病人行射频导管消融治疗。在射频导管消融术中发生TCAVB者为I组(n=6),无TCAVB者为I组(n=50)。用t检验和χ2检验对所有指标进行统计学分析。结果:两组的平均放电次数、释放能量、放电时间及A/V比值均无显著差异(P>0.05),但消融电极位置偏高者I组占66.7%,I组占12.0%(P<0.001)。在随访期间,I组2例(33.3%)发生迟发性房室传导阻滞,I组则无迟发性房室传导阻滞发生(P<0.001)。结论:射频导管消融术中出现的TCAVB与术后发生的迟发性房室传导阻滞密切相关。  相似文献

Wolff–Parkinson–White syndrome (WPW) is defined as a condition involving an accessory pathway associated with symptoms. A typical ECG pattern of a pre-excitation shows a short PQ interval, presence of delta wave and a broad QRS complex on surface ECG. The underlying mechanism involves an accessory pathway, which enables conduction of a depolarization wave from atria to ventricles bypassing the AV node and predisposes to arrhythmias and sudden cardiac death. The most common arrhythmia in patients with WPW syndrome is atrioventricular reentrant tachycardia. However, it is not present in all patients with pre-excitation [1], [2], [3], [4]. Up to 1/3 of patients with AVRT experience atrial fibrillation, which may be conducted to ventricular myocardium via the accessory pathway and lead to a life-threatening ventricular fibrillation. The most effective treatment of the WPW syndrome is a radiofrequency catheter ablation [2], [5], [6], [7], [8]. This paper describes a case of a 40-year-old woman after a cardiopulmonary resuscitation for ventricular fibrillation, which was a primary manifestation of the WPW syndrome. It focuses on pathophysiology, clinical pattern and treatment possibilities of patients with WPW syndrome.  相似文献

Permanent form of junctional reciprocating tachycardia (PJRT) is an uncommon form of atrioventricular re-entrant tachycardia due to an accessory pathway characterized by slow and decremental retrograde conduction. The majority of accessory pathways in PJRT are localized in the posteroseptal zone. Despite the high success rate, failure may occur during endocardial radiofrequency catheter ablation due to epicardial insertion of the accessory pathway. We report a case of PJRT in a 25-year-old man in whom the accessory pathway was located epicardially in the posteroinferior region and ablated from within the middle cardiac vein by radiofrequency catheter ablation.  相似文献

AIMS: Although arrhythmia surgery and radiofrequency catheter ablation to cure atrioventricular nodal reentrant tachycardia differ in technical concept, the late results of both methods, in terms of elimination of the arrhythmogenic substrate and procedure-related new and different arrhythmias, have never been compared. This constituted the purpose of this prospective follow-up study. METHODS AND RESULTS: Between 1988 and 1992, 26 patients were surgically treated using perinodal dissection or 'skeletonization', and from 1991 up to 1995, 120 patients underwent radiofrequency modification of the atrioventricular node for atrioventricular nodal reentrant tachycardia. The acute success rates of surgery and radiofrequency catheter ablation were 96% and 92%, respectively. Late recurrence, rate in the surgical and radiofrequency catheter ablation groups was 12% and 17%, respectively. Mean follow-up was 53 months in the surgical group and 28 months in the radiofrequency catheter ablation group. The final success rate after repeat intervention was 100% in the surgical group and 98% in the radiofrequency catheter ablation group. Comparison of the initial and recent series of radiofrequency catheter ablated patients showed an increased initial success rate with fewer applications. In the radiofrequency catheter ablation group, a second- or third-degree block developed in three patients (2%), requiring permanent pacing, whereas in the surgical group no complete atrioventricular block was observed. Inappropriate sinus tachycardia needing drug treatment was observed in 13 patients (11%), mostly after fast pathway ablation, but was never observed after surgery. New and different supraventricular tachyarrhythmias arose in 27% of the patients in the surgical group and in 11% of the radiofrequency catheter ablation group, but did not clearly differ. CONCLUSION: This one-institutional follow-up study demonstrated comparable initial and late success rates as well as incidence of new and different supraventricular arrhythmias following arrhythmia surgery and radiofrequency catheter ablation for atrioventricular nodal reentrant tachycardia. Today radiofrequency catheter ablation has replaced arrhythmia surgery for various reasons, but the late arrhythmic side-effects warrant refinement of technique.  相似文献

Radiofrequency ablation of atrioventricular accessory pathway in patients with WPW syndrome: Seventeen accessory pathways in 15 patients with Wolff-Parkinson-White syndrome (WPW) were ablated with radiofrequency current. There were 15 accessory pathways located on the left side of the heart (12 left free wall, 1 posterioseptal, 1 posteriolateral and 1 midseptal) and 2 pathways on the right side (1 right free wall, 1 anterioseptal). 16 accessory pathways (94.1%) in 14 patients were permanently abolished. Plasma CK-Mb, SGOT and LDH increased moderately in 7 cases (46.7%) and decreased to normal level in 3-4 days. Conclusion: catheter ablation of accessory pathways with radiofrequency current is a safe and effective therapeutic method for patients with refractory tachycardias mediated by these pathways. II. Radiofrequency ablation of slow pathways to cure AV nodal reentrant tachycardia: Radiofrequency energy was used to selectively ablate the slow pathways in 8 patients with atrioventricular nodal reentrant tachycardia. The slow pathways in all 8 cases were ablated successfully and no episodes of tachycardia could be induced. The A-H, H-V interval and P-R interval of ECG did not change significantly. The Wenckebach points of atrioventricular node remained unchanged. The effective refractory periods of the fast pathways were shortened in 3 and prolonged in 5 cases after the procedure. There were no severe complications. No tachycardia recurred during the follow-up period between 2 weeks and 7 months.  相似文献

预激合并室上性快速心律失常所致的心肌病   总被引:4,自引:1,他引:4  
4例因长期心动过速而发生心功能障碍的患者,经检查除外其他器质性心脏病后,予以射频消融终止心动过速。分别于术后2周及4个月行超声心动图检查,结果显示LVEF、LVEDD、LVESD均较术前有明显改善。提示对于长期快速心律失常患者,即使在心功能受损的情况下,也应积极治疗,以便改善患者预后。  相似文献

AIMS: Atrial fibrillation represents a frequent and potentially life-threatening arrhythmia in patients with accessory atrioventricular pathways. Radiofrequency ablation has become the curative treatment of first choice for these patients. Investigations after successful surgical pathway dissection reported an almost complete elimination of paroxysmal atrial fibrillation. However, there are only a few reports which include a small number of patients undergoing radiofrequency ablation. The purpose of this study was to examine whether successful radiofrequency ablation of accessory pathways prevents the occurrence of paroxysmal atrial fibrillation, and to identify possible predictors of atrial fibrillation recurrence. METHODS AND RESULTS: A total of 116 consecutive patients (mean age 42+/-15 years) with manifest or concealed accessory pathways and documented paroxysmal atrial fibrillation underwent radiofrequency catheter ablation. The patients were reexamined at 6 and 12 months. Long-term follow-up information was obtained by questionnaire and/or by consulting the referring physician. Pathway conduction was abolished in 101 cases (87%). Late follow-up information was obtained from 91 of these 101 patients (90%) with successful ablation with a mean follow-up duration of 23.9+/-12.3 months. During follow-up, 25 of 91 patients (27%) experienced arrhythmias. Recurrent episodes of atrial fibrillation were observed in 18 of these 25 cases (i.e. 20% of the 91 patients). Differences between patients with and without recurrences of atrial fibrillation were examined for age, sex, associated cardiac disease, presence of multiple pathways, pathway location, atrial fibrillation inducibility during the procedure and cycle length of the atrioventricular reentrant tachycardia. Only older age was a significant independent predictor of atrial fibrillation recurrence (P=0.02). Eleven of 31 patients (35%) older than 50 years of age had atrial fibrillation recurrences during follow-up compared to seven of 60 patients (12%) under age 50. The recurrence rate of atrial fibrillation was even higher in patients older than 60 years (6 of 11 patients, i.e. 55%). In comparison, the occurrence rate of atrial fibrillation during follow-up in a control group of 100 consecutive patients with successful accessory pathway ablation, who did not have evidence of paroxysmal atrial fibrillation prior to ablation, was 4% and, thus, significantly lower than in the study group of the 91 patients (P=0.001). CONCLUSIONS: The recurrence rate of paroxysmal atrial fibrillation after successful radiofrequency ablation of accessory pathways shows an age-related increase, being low in patients younger than 50 years of age (12%) and high in the older patients: 35% in patients older than 50 years and 55% in patients older than 60. These results have significant therapeutic implications concerning the decisions on pharmacological therapy after successful ablation in patients older than 50 years. Furthermore, these data will help physicians advise older patients properly about their risk of recurrence of atrial fibrillation after ablation.  相似文献
